1928 Color Print Cambodian Bridge Stone Khmer Empire Architecture Infrastructure YPA1 "His gift for portraying manners"Seven Centuries Ago the Khmers Built This Bridge of Stone" This is an original 1928 color print of a stone bridge built by the Khmer Empire over 700 years ago. As the concept of the arch was still unknown to the architects of Angkor, the bridge is made with single pillars placed so close together, it resembles a solid wall.
